Air Fryer Quesadilla

These air fryer quesadillas are super easy, healthy, and come out perfectly crisp with a creamy cheesy center!

Ingredients

  • 8 whole-grain tortillas
  • 1 ⅓ cups shredded Mexican cheese blend
  • 1 cup refried beans
  • 1 green bell pepper, deveined and seeded
  • 1 red bell pepper, deveined and seeded
  • cooking spray

Instructions

  • Dice bell peppers.
  • Preheat Air Fryer to 350F.
  • Assemble quesadillas by spreading ¼ cup of refried beans over one quesadilla, top with ⅓ cup cheese, and ¼ of the bell peppers. Place the other tortilla on top.
  • Spray bottom with cooking spray and place in air fryer rack. IMPORTANT! Place a trivet or something to weigh down on the top half of the tortilla. I used one of the accessory racks that came with the Air Fryer accessory kit I bought. If you don't, the tortilla on top may fly up and get burnt to shreds. Luckily, when this happened to me, I recognized the burning smell and stopped the air fryer before anything catastrophic happened to me.
  • Cook quesadillas for 4 minutes, then flip, cook until golden brown and crispy on the outside and melty cheese on the inside! How do you flip? I used air fryer parchment liners that I could pull out easily iwth the quesadilla on them, then flip the whole thing, but it wasn't the easiest thing I've ever done!

Notes

Make sure and weigh down your quesadillas in the air fryer!
